A test is reported in which a VHF-FM radio communication system was used to control the compressors of central air-conditioning systems of 50 residential customers and 35 small commercial customers in Rhode Island between the hours of 12:00 and 5:00 pm during weekdays from June through September of 1988. Topics discussed include recruitment of participants, pre-experiment testing, equipment performance, and analysis of results. The hourly diversified demand reduction attributable to control was 1.0 to 1.6 kW per residence during control hours when the average outside temperature ranges from 88 to 95°F. Commercial units showed a relatively constant demand reduction, on the order of 2.5 kW, at all temperatures in excess of 80°F  相似文献

This paper documents the impact of microprocessor technology on electrical engineering education at the University of Rhode Island. Originally introduced as a method of giving computer experience to a larger number of students, it has become a key element in the undergraduate curriculum. "Microprocessor Laboratory" emphasizes hands-on experience by making computers available for "checkout" use at home. It is introduced as a required course at the sophomore level and the textbooks used are manufacturers' manuals. We employ a series of nine basic exercises and couple these to an end-of-semester project. The course is offered each semester and attracts students from other engineering disciplines and from other colleges within the University. It has been successfully adapted to a five-week summer session and a four-day short course for engineering faculty. The course forms the basis for introducing microprocessors into other, more advanced engineering courses.  相似文献

Analysis of thermal stresses in tubes and a compensator, taking into account water heating in each heater bunch and temperature at which its mounting is implemented, and of stresses on pressure is presented. The 3D-model of the horizontal delivery water heater of PSG-4900-0.3-1.14 type is used. The tube plate is represented as the 3D-body with 6863 holes with offset center of the perforated area, the steam space shell is represented as a cylindrical casing, the bottoms of water chambers are considered as elliptical casings, the four-lens compensator is represented in the form of toroidal casings, and the tubes are considered as beams operating in tensile-compression and bending in two planes. Calculations were carried out for different temperatures of superheated steam and a steam space shell, respectively, as well as designs with compensator and without it. Various temperature values of the tubes on the passes were calculated and set. The studies were carried out taking into account nonaxis-symmetrical spacing the tube plate and compensator deformation. The calculation results of tensile-compression stresses in the tubes are presented. Furthermore, the central tubes experience compressive stresses, whose maximal values take place on the border between the tubes of the fourth and of the first passes. For its decrease, it is recommended to increase the distance between the tubes of these passes. The tension stresses in the peripheral tubes are the maximal stresses. To reduce the stresses and, therefore, increase service life of the delivery water heater at using wet or superheated (not more than by 30–50°C) steam in it (the larger value refers to the brass tubes and the water pressure of 1.6–2.5 MPa), it is necessary to recommend the noncompensatory design at using the steam superheated by more than 30–50°C (at Ural Turbine Works, it is the turbines of T-250/300-23.5 and T-113/145-12.4 types with intermediate superheating) and to recommend the installation of the compensator operating only at compression.  相似文献

根据GB 21519-2008储水式电热水器能效限定值的技术要求,设计并建造了一套由空气处理系统、恒温水系统、数据采集系统、电气控制系统组成的6工位储水式电热水器性能实验室.该测试系统可以从额定容积,24小时固有能耗,热水输出率三个指标来对储水式电热水嚣性能做出评价.经过验收审核,该储水式电热水器性能测试实验室测试精度满足作为国家检测机构评定使用,自动化程度高,使用简单.  相似文献

居民电热水器是一种典型的热储能负荷,用电产生的热水具有热存储性,可以消纳波动性风电。提出了用于消纳风电的电热水器负荷群滑模控制策略,来实时控制电热水器负荷群。控制率与电热水器群数量、热水使用情况等相关,对于消纳风电具有较强的鲁棒性。采用某城区居民区电热水器负荷群的仿真研究表明,提出的电热水器群滑模控制策略能有效消纳风电,验证了电热水器负荷群滑模控制策略有效性。  相似文献

Analysis of engineering solutions aimed at a considerable decrease of solar water heaters cost via the use of polymer composites in heaters construction and solar collector and heat storage integration into a single device representing an integrated unit results are considered. Possibilities of creating solar water heaters of only three components and changing welding, soldering, mechanical treatment, and assembly of a complicate construction for large components molding of polymer composites and their gluing are demonstrated. Materials of unit components and engineering solutions for their manufacturing are analyzed with consideration for construction requirements of solar water heaters. Optimal materials are fiber glass and carbon-filled plastics based on hot-cure thermosets, and an optimal molding technology is hot molding. It is necessary to manufacture the absorbing panel as corrugated and to use a special paint as its selective coating. Parameters of the unit have been optimized by calculation. Developed two-dimensional numerical model of the unit demonstrates good agreement with the experiment. Optimal ratio of daily load to receiving surface area of a solar water heater operating on a clear summer day in the midland of Russia is 130?150 L/m2. Storage tank volume and load schedule have a slight effect on solar water heater output. A thermal insulation layer of 35?40 mm is sufficient to provide an efficient thermal insulation of the back and side walls. An experimental model layout representing a solar water heater prototype of a prime cost of $70?90/(m2 receiving surface) has been developed for a manufacturing volume of no less than 5000 pieces per year.  相似文献

The macroscopic regularities and integrated characteristics of the motion and evaporation of sprayed water droplets in the field of high-temperature (1100 K) combustion products under the conditions typical for water heaters of contact type (economizers) were studied using a cross-correlation complex working on the basis of panoramic optical methods (particle image velocimetry, particle tracking velocimetry, shadow photography) and high-speed (105 fps) Phantom video cameras. High-speed video recording devices with specialized software were used for continuously monitoring the motion and evaporation of droplets. Titanium dioxide nanopowder tracer particles were introduced to determine the rate of high-temperature gases. The characteristic distances covered by water droplets before their full retardation in the counter-flow of high-temperature combustion products were determined. The integrated dependences were obtained, and the main characteristics of evaporation were determined, which allow one to predict the intensity of the phase transformations of droplets (with sizes of 0.05–0.5 mm) and the distances covered by them before they completely turn in the opposite direction under the conditions corresponding to the heat-exchange chambers of contact water heaters: the vapor-droplet rate 1–5 m/s, gas flow rate 0.5–2 m/s, and gas temperature ~1100 K. Approximating expressions were derived to predict the characteristics of the processes. The performance of the economizers under study can be significantly increased by using the obtained experimental dependences, the corresponding approximating expressions, and the resulting conclusions. Conditions were determined under which the influence of phase transformations on retardation exceeds the contribution of the counter-motion and active retardation and evaporation of water droplets occur in the heat-exchange chambers of contact water heaters of typical sizes.  相似文献

解决国产300MW机组给水低压加热器疏水系统存在的问题,交原设计为疏水逐级自流与疏水泵相结合的连接方式,以疏水逐级自流与外置式疏水冷却器相结合的方式来取代,不仅计算热经济性相当,而且因取消了转动设备疏水泵,提高了系统实际运行的经济性和安全性。  相似文献

结合大型电感应热水机组的应用背景,设计了利用大型电感应热水机组的感应线圈及漏电感、补偿电容组成的超音频IGBT-FB-ZVS-PWM谐振变换器,通过工作过程分析和样机运行表明,装置具有功率调节简便、器件损耗小、性能可靠、运行噪音低等优点.使得大型电感应热水机组能够广泛地用于居民生活和工业生产等需要加热水的场所.  相似文献

对热力发电厂中低压加热器疏水系统所采用的不同疏水方式进行分析,通过对不同疏水方式的比较和计算,表明300 MW机组的低加回热系统采用疏水冷却器比采用低加疏水泵更经济、安全.  相似文献

虚拟振荡器控制(virtual oscillator control, VOC)策略是一种新型分布式控制方法,在离网和并网逆变器中具有巨大的应用潜力。然而,当负载变化及非线性不平衡负载接入系统时,基于VOC的离网逆变器系统会存在频率偏差和谐波问题。针对上述不足,通过分析混合负载对电力系统造成的影响,提出一种改进的VOC策略,并引入电压、电流正负序分离技术,设计了二次频率补偿器。同时改进了电压电流双闭环控制结构,进一步提高了系统抑制谐波的能力。在Matlab/Simulink平台中搭建了离网逆变器系统仿真模型。通过与传统VOC进行对比,验证了所提控制策略在解决频率偏差和抑制谐波问题中的有效性。  相似文献
